Thanks to all those who shared their work, experience and ideas with the national and international delegates of the 6th Canadian River Heritage Conference, through the submission of an abstract.
The submission response was tremendous and, in turn, will offer delegates exceptional concurrent sessions throughout the conference. Each abstract will be related to one of the three conference sub-themes:
- Sustaining our river heritage
- Promoting heritage and recreational opportunities
- Optimizing economic and social benefits
Papers:
Selected abstracts (papers) are posted on the Conference Program and will be presented during the concurrent sessions scheduled throughout the conference.
Posters:
Selected abstracts (posters) will be displayed in a central location throughout the four days of the conference. Individuals displaying posters will have an opportunity to share their ideas and discuss their work at designated times during the conference.
